// No getLoginToken here on purpose. POST /_matrix/client/v1/login/get_token
|
||||
// is rate limited to 1 request per user per MINUTE, hardcoded in Synapse
|
||||
// (rest/client/login_token_request.py: "Ratelimit aggressively … could be
|
||||
// abused by a malicious client to create many sessions") and not settable
|
||||
// from homeserver.yaml. A second click inside a minute got M_LIMIT_EXCEEDED.
|
||||
// ChatSsoService hands Element the session from loginWithJwt directly
|
||||
// instead, which needs no second call.

/**
|
||||
* Force-join, treating "already a member" as success. Synapse answers a
|
||||
* repeat join with 403 `M_FORBIDDEN: "<user> is already in the room."`, which
|
||||
* is a failure only if you assumed you knew the membership first. Callers
|
||||
* that just want someone in a room (sign-in, reconcile racing itself) want
|
||||
* this; the raw 403 tells them nothing they can act on.
|
||||
*/
|
||||
async ensureJoined(roomIdOrAlias: string, userId: string): Promise<void> {
|
||||
try {
|
||||
await this.forceJoin(roomIdOrAlias, userId);
|
||||
} catch (err) {
|
||||
if (!/already in the room/i.test((err as Error).message)) throw err;
|
||||
}
|
||||
}

# Turning rooms' encryption off above is not enough on its own: Element still
|
||||
# bootstraps cross-signing on a user's first login, and from then on gates
|
||||
# EVERY later login behind "Verify this device" (MatrixChat: crossSigningIsSetUp
|
||||
# -> Views.COMPLETE_SECURITY). Nobody on this deployment can clear that gate —
|
||||
# each SSO click is a brand-new device, so there is never a second verified
|
||||
# device to accept the request, and resetting the identity needs UIA, which
|
||||
# password_config.enabled: false makes impossible.
|
||||
#
|
||||
# This tells Element encryption is off here, so it skips the bootstrap
|
||||
# (shouldSkipSetupEncryption) and the gate is never armed. Only helps accounts
|
||||
# that have no cross-signing keys yet — anyone already bootstrapped keeps
|
||||
# hitting the gate until their keys are cleared.
|
||||
extra_well_known_client_content:
|
||||
io.element.e2ee:
|
||||
default: false
|
||||
force_disable: true
|
||||
secure_backup_required: false
